"[A] smart Orwellian thriller set in a near-future U.K. where the financial impact of several pandemics has led to drastic measures... Marrs builds on techno-dystopian ideas explored in prior books to craft a scarily plausible world. Readers will be riveted."—Publishers Weekly
 
"The characters (both central and supporting) are vividly drawn, and their stories uniquely captivating. Marrs transforms a slightly out-there premise into a gripping, completely believable story full of surprises that prompt reflection. Absolutely compelling.”—Booklist
